Regional settings

On the “Regional settings” page you can adjust how dates, amounts, and data entries are displayed throughout the system. You can configure the date format, amount formatting, and the number of entries per page for data tables.

Date display and Export formats

Choose your preferred date format for display and data exports:

  • ISO 8601 – 2025-02-14 10:55
  • American – 02/14/2025 10:55 AM
  • European – 14.02.2025 10:55

Thousands Separator

  • No delimiters -1234567890.36
  • single quote (‘) – 1’234’567’890.36
  • Backtick (`) – 1`234`567`890.36
  • Single space – 1 234 567 890.36

Decimal formatting

  • Separate cents with dot -1 234 567 890.36
  • Separate cents with comma – 1 234 567 890,36
  • Cut off decimal part when editing – 1 234 567 890

Note: For the Amount export format, the chosen formatting applies to text-based exports (e.g. CSV). For the Excel export, amounts are exported as native numeric values, so the formatting is not applicable there.

Entries per page

Define the number of entries displayed per page in data tables. Available options: 10, 25, 50, 100, 250, 500, 1000.
